跳到主要内容

leaderboard points - 积分排行榜命令

命令名称

/leaderboard points

描述

此命令允许您查看服务器的积分排行榜。您可以根据不同时间段筛选排行榜、设置自定义日期范围,并指定要显示的成员数量。

用法

/leaderboard points [period] [date_range] [limit]

参数

可选参数:

  • [period]:指定排行榜的时间范围。

    • All:显示用户自加入以来累积的总积分,减去任何扣除或兑换。这是默认值。
    • Today:显示从今天 00:00(服务器时区)到现在的积分。
    • This Week:(高级版)显示从本周一 00:00(服务器时区)到现在的积分。
    • This Month:(高级版)显示从本月 1 日 00:00(服务器时区)到现在的积分。
    • 7-Day:(高级版)显示从当前时间起过去 7 个滚动日内的积分。
    • 30-Day:(高级版)显示从当前时间起过去 30 个滚动日内的积分。
    • Custom:(旗舰版)允许您使用 date_range 参数指定自定义日期范围。
    重要提示:
    • period 设置为 All 时,排行榜显示每位成员的当前积分余额,包括他们获得的所有积分减去已花费的任何积分。
    • 对于所有其他时间段(例如,TodayThis WeekCustom),排行榜显示每位成员在该特定时间段内获得的总积分,无论其当前余额如何。
  • [date_range]:此参数仅在 period 设置为 Custom 时使用。它允许您指定排行榜的单个日期或日期范围。

    • 单日:对于特定日期,使用 YYYY-MM-DD,YYYY-MM-DD 格式(例如,2025-07-07,2025-07-07 表示 2025 年 7 月 7 日)。
    • 日期范围:使用 YYYY-MM-DD,YYYY-MM-DD 格式指定一个范围,包括开始和结束日期(例如,2025-07-01,2025-07-07)。
    • 开始日期至今:使用 YYYY-MM-DD 格式(例如,2025-07-01)显示从指定开始日期到当前时间的积分。
  • [limit]:指定要在排行榜上显示的前几名成员数量。支持的最大值为 100。默认值为 10

示例

  • 示例 1:查看显示前 10 名成员的整体积分排行榜。

    /leaderboard points
  • 示例 2:查看今天积分排行榜,显示前 10 名成员。

    /leaderboard points period:Today
  • 示例 3:查看本周积分排行榜,显示前 20 名成员。

    /leaderboard points period:"This Week" limit:20
  • 示例 4:查看本月积分排行榜,显示前 30 名成员。

    /leaderboard points period:"This Month" limit:30
  • 示例 5:查看过去 7 天的排行榜,显示前 15 名成员。

    /leaderboard points period:"7-Day" limit:15
  • 示例 6:仅查看 2025 年 7 月 1 日的排行榜。

    /leaderboard points period:Custom date_range:2025-07-01,2025-07-01
  • 示例 7:查看 2025 年 7 月第一周的积分排行榜,显示前 50 名成员。

    /leaderboard points period:Custom date_range:2025-07-01,2025-07-07 limit:50
  • 示例 8:查看从 2025 年 7 月 1 日至今的积分排行榜。

    /leaderboard points period:Custom date_range:2025-07-01

注意事项

  • 只有管理员权限的成员才能执行 /leaderboard points 命令。
  • 排行榜上的“刷新”按钮对所有成员可见且可点击,但两次点击之间有 5 分钟的冷却时间。
  • “我的排名”按钮所有成员均可点击,但只会显示他们自己的排名。
  • 某些 period 选项(This WeekThis Month7-Day30-Day)需要高级版。
  • Custom 时间段选项需要旗舰版。
  • date_range 参数仅适用于 period 设置为 Custom 时。

常见问题

  • 问:普通成员可以看到排行榜吗?

    答:虽然只有管理员才能使用 /leaderboard points 命令生成排行榜,但现有排行榜显示上的"刷新"和"我的排名"按钮对所有成员可见且可点击。

  • 问:我可以在排行榜上显示的最大成员数量是多少?

    答:您可以使用 limit 参数在排行榜上显示最多 100 名成员。

  • 问:我是否需要特殊订阅才能查看"本周"或"自定义"等特定时间段的排行榜?

    答:是的,"本周"、"本月"、"7 天"和"30 天"时间段需要高级版。"自定义"时间段需要旗舰版。